Narrowband Multispectral Filter Market Insights

Global Narrowband Multispectral Filter market size was valued at USD 312.5 million in 2025. The market is projected to grow from USD 342.7 million in 2026 to USD 685.4 million by 2034, exhibiting a CAGR of 9.1% during the forecast period.

Narrowband Multispectral Filters are optical filters that selectively transmit light in specific narrow wavelength bands while blocking others. These filters are essential for precise spectral separation, enabling applications in multispectral imaging, remote sensing, medical imaging, environmental monitoring, and scientific research.

The market is experiencing strong growth due to surging demand for high-resolution imaging in agriculture, defense, and biomedical fields. Rising adoption of drones and satellites for remote sensing, coupled with advancements in fabrication techniques like thin-film deposition, further propel expansion. Key players such as Allied Scientific Pro, SILIOS Technologies, Salvo Technologies, Koshin Kogaku, Giai Photonics, Mloptic, Champion Optics, Daheng Optical Thin Film, and Shenzhen NMOT dominate with innovative portfolios, driving competition and technological progress.

MARKET DRIVERS

Precision Agriculture and Remote Sensing

Narrowband Multispectral Filter Market is propelled by increasing adoption in precision agriculture, where these filters enable detailed crop health monitoring through drone-based imaging systems. Farmers utilize narrowband filters to detect subtle variations in chlorophyll content and nutrient deficiencies, optimizing yields by up to 15-20% in major grain-producing regions.

Defense and Surveillance Applications

In defense sectors, demand surges for Narrowband Multispectral Filter Market due to enhanced target detection in low-light conditions and camouflage penetration. Military hyperspectral cameras equipped with these filters improve reconnaissance accuracy, contributing to a projected segment growth of over 10% annually through 2030.

Integration with AI-driven analytics boosts real-time data processing, driving market expansion in autonomous systems.

Additionally, medical imaging advancements, such as fluorescence microscopy, further accelerate Narrowband Multispectral Filter Market by enabling precise disease diagnostics with minimal tissue damage.

MARKET CHALLENGES

High Manufacturing Complexity

Narrowband Multispectral Filter Market faces hurdles from intricate fabrication processes requiring ultra-precise thin-film deposition, leading to yields below 80% in high-volume production. This elevates costs, deterring small-scale adopters in emerging applications.

Other Challenges

Supply Chain Disruptions

Geopolitical tensions and raw material shortages, like specialty glass substrates, have increased lead times by 25-30%, impacting delivery in Narrowband Multispectral Filter Market.

Integration difficulties with existing multispectral camera systems also pose issues, necessitating custom calibrations that extend development cycles by several months. Competition from cost-effective broadband alternatives further pressures market penetration in consumer-grade devices.

MARKET RESTRAINTS

Regulatory and Standardization Barriers

Stringent regulatory approvals for medical and aerospace uses in Narrowband Multispectral Filter Market slow commercialization, with certification processes often spanning 18-24 months. Lack of universal wavelength standards across vendors complicates interoperability.

High initial investment for R&D in advanced coatings restrains smaller players, limiting innovation to dominant firms holding over 60% market share. Economic slowdowns in key regions also curb capital spending on high-end imaging equipment.

Environmental concerns over rare-earth materials used in filter production add compliance costs, potentially raising prices by 10-15% amid sustainability mandates.

MARKET OPPORTUNITIES

Expansion in Environmental Monitoring

Narrowband Multispectral Filter Market presents strong potential in environmental monitoring, where satellite and UAV deployments track deforestation and pollution with spectral precision, eyeing a 12% CAGR through 2028.

Emerging applications in autonomous vehicles for enhanced object detection in varied lighting open new avenues, integrating filters with LiDAR for safer navigation systems.

Asia-Pacific growth, driven by industrial automation and smart cities, could capture 25% additional market share, fueled by investments exceeding $5 billion in sensor technologies.

By Technology
  • Interference Filters
  • Absorptive Filters
  • Hybrid Filters
Interference Filters prevail for their superior optical qualities.

  • Deliver sharp spectral selectivity essential for multispectral discrimination.
  • Offer high transmission rates and steep edges for noise-free imaging.
  • Compatible with array fabrication for compact multispectral cameras.
  • Resistant to angular shifts, ideal for dynamic scanning applications.
By Form Factor
  • Planar Arrays
  • Filter Wheels
  • On-chip Integration
On-chip Integration gains traction for miniaturized systems.

  • Enables snapshot multispectral imaging without moving parts.
  • Reduces footprint for portable and UAV-mounted sensors.
  • Improves alignment precision in focal plane arrays.
  • Supports cost-effective scaling in consumer and professional devices.
